当前位置:网站首页>AI automatically generates annotation documents from code
AI automatically generates annotation documents from code
2022-07-05 20:33:00 【Small box】
Two things programmers hate most :
Write your own notes Others don't write notes
Mintlify Our plug-in can finally save us from the painful dead cycle .
Mintlify utilize AI Technology automatically generates annotation documents from code
Be careful it's free
But who knows , Maybe after a while, it's like github Of Copilot
It's also possible to start charging .
To a Demo
For example, my simple paragraph Two points search
Program fragment :
Let's have a look at Mintlify
Comments generated for it , Be careful : It can generate multilingual , There are English and Chinese
All the above are generated automatically , From the result, it is a program-based translation , Quite wordy , But it's still accurate .
application
All right. , The remaining thing is to generate comments on your finished program with one click , Then one with good ( repetitive ) The annotated code is written , If your team counts the number of lines of code and comments ( Which team is so SB, Tell me , Avoid a pit ), Then I finished happily KPI
.
To make fun of , Good code comments , It is not only beneficial for others to read , It's better to maintain , Sometimes it takes a long time , We don't even know what it is , Sometimes I start scolding when I see a large piece of program written around without comments :“ this TM What kind of writing ”, Ironically , Sometimes , I wrote the program myself . ha-ha .
It is said that excellent code can do Self explanation
, You can understand it without writing notes , Yes , That's excellent code , Before you can write code like that , Write notes, son , First make sure you won't be scolded by your classmates in the team .
Tips
If you encounter network problems during plug-in installation or use , Please solve it by yourself through scientific Internet . Such as this thing (https://www.mintlify.com/) It's starting to charge , When I didn't say .
边栏推荐
- Propping of resources
- 信息学奥赛一本通 1337:【例3-2】单词查找树 | 洛谷 P5755 [NOI2000] 单词查找树
- Bzoj 3747 poi2015 kinoman segment tree
- 基础篇——配置文件解析
- Hongmeng OS' fourth learning
- 小程序代码的构成
- Wechat applet regular expression extraction link
- [quick start of Digital IC Verification] 6. Quick start of questasim (taking the design and verification of full adder as an example)
- 欢迎来战,赢取丰厚奖金:Code Golf 代码高尔夫挑战赛正式启动
- Y57. Chapter III kubernetes from entry to proficiency -- business image version upgrade and rollback (30)
猜你喜欢
Station B up builds the world's first pure red stone neural network, pornographic detection based on deep learning action recognition, Chen Tianqi's course progress of machine science compilation MLC,
小程序页面导航
Leetcode(695)——岛屿的最大面积
[quick start of Digital IC Verification] 1. Talk about Digital IC Verification, understand the contents of the column, and clarify the learning objectives
【数字IC验证快速入门】2、通过一个SoC项目实例,了解SoC的架构,初探数字系统设计流程
. Net distributed transaction and landing solution
[Yugong series] go teaching course in July 2022 004 go code Notes
Applet page navigation
Fundamentals - configuration file analysis
[quick start of Digital IC Verification] 9. Finite state machine (FSM) necessary for Verilog RTL design
随机推荐
Nprogress plug-in progress bar
2022年7月4日-2022年7月10日(ue4视频教程mysql)
July 4, 2022 - July 10, 2022 (UE4 video tutorial MySQL)
Leetcode (695) - the largest area of an island
What is PyC file
【愚公系列】2022年7月 Go教学课程 004-Go代码注释
[quick start of Digital IC Verification] 1. Talk about Digital IC Verification, understand the contents of the column, and clarify the learning objectives
【数字IC验证快速入门】8、数字IC中的典型电路及其对应的Verilog描述方法
ICTCLAS word Lucene 4.9 binding
欢迎来战,赢取丰厚奖金:Code Golf 代码高尔夫挑战赛正式启动
19 Mongoose模块化
Leetcode brush question: binary tree 13 (the same tree)
Scala basics [HelloWorld code parsing, variables and identifiers]
Oracle tablespace management
Zero cloud new UI design
Schema and model
Ffplay document [easy to understand]
.Net分布式事務及落地解决方案
死信队列入门(两个消费者,一个生产者)
mongodb/文档操作